Unexpected Prop Combinations That Bring Spring Displays to Life

Unexpected Prop Combinations That Bring Spring Displays to Life

Creative displays often emerge from unusual combinations. Vintage bicycles paired with flowers, rustic crates mixed with modern furniture, or garden tools displayed alongside fashion products can create unique visual interest.

Color Psychology Secrets Behind High-Performing Spring Windows

Color Psychology Secrets Behind High-Performing Spring Windows

Color influences emotions more than many retailers realize. Soft greens often suggest freshness. Yellow communicates optimism. Pink creates warmth and friendliness. Understanding these emotional triggers can significantly improve display performance.

Common Spring Display Mistakes Quietly Hurting Store Visibility

Common Spring Display Mistakes Quietly Hurting Store Visibility

Many retailers overcrowd their displays with excessive decorations. Too many colors, products, or props can confuse customers and weaken the overall message. Simplicity often creates stronger results.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the best spring window display ideas for retail stores?

The most effective displays combine flowers, seasonal colors, themed props, and strong product placement. Retailers often achieve excellent results using vibrant spring decorations, floral installations, and interactive elements that encourage customer engagement.

How can I create a spring window display on a budget?

Affordable materials from Michaels, Hobby Lobby, and Etsy can help create professional displays. Reusable props, DIY decorations, and creative planning often reduce costs while maintaining quality.

Which colors work best in spring storefront displays?

Soft greens, pastel pinks, lavender, sky blue, and warm yellow tones work exceptionally well. These colors align naturally with seasonal themes and create welcoming shopping environments.

How often should spring window displays be updated?

Most retailers refresh displays every two to four weeks. Regular updates keep storefronts fresh and encourage repeat visitors to notice new products and promotions.

What props attract the most attention in spring displays?

Flowers, butterflies, garden accessories, lighting features, seasonal signage, and creative props often attract the highest levels of customer attention during spring.
